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
High Profitability & MarginsSustained high gross and operating margins signal durable competitive unit economics from First Solar’s CdTe technology and manufacturing scale. Strong margins improve cash generation and resilience versus cyclical module price swings, supporting reinvestment and maintaining returns even if near-term volumes vary.
Conservative Balance Sheet / Cash PositionExtremely low leverage and a net cash position provide financial flexibility to fund domestic capacity builds, weather tariff-driven demand shifts, and absorb underutilization charges without forced asset sales or dilutive financing, preserving strategic optionality over the medium term.
Large Contracted Backlog & Strong U.S. UtilizationA multi-year backlog combined with ~96% U.S. plant utilization provides tangible revenue visibility and production cadence. High domestic utilization plus upcoming South Carolina finishing capacity reduce freight/tariff exposure and support reliable deliveries and margin realization through the next several quarters.
Bears Say
Tariff & Policy UncertaintyActive trade investigations and temporary tariff windows create structural demand and pricing uncertainty that affects contract selection, booking cadence, and factory allocation. Management’s assumptions could change quickly, making forward-looking volume and margin plans sensitive to policy outcomes over the next few months.
Underutilization & SE Asia Capacity RiskLower utilization in Malaysia/Vietnam raises per-unit fixed costs and can depress margins and cash flow until capacity is reallocated or demand normalizes. Planned tool reallocation to pilots further reduces finished throughput, creating durable near-term cadence and cost pressure until reshoring or demand shifts resolve.
Regulatory & IP Litigation RiskActive investigations and evolving India ALMM rules introduce execution and market-access risk. Litigation and regulatory changes can restrict market opportunities, delay projects, or require licensing, forcing management to divert resources and potentially impacting bookings and margin realization across key markets.

Company Description
First Solar
First Solar, Inc. is a global provider of photovoltaic (PV) solar energy solutions, operating in numerous international markets including the United States, Japan, France, Canada, India, and Australia. The company's primary activity involves the engineering, manufacturing, and sale of cadmium telluride solar modules, which are designed to convert solar radiation directly into electricity. Its clientele is broad, serving system developers and operators, utility companies, independent power producers, commercial and industrial businesses, and various other system owners. Founded in 1999, the firm is based in Tempe, Arizona, and underwent a name change in 2006 from its former designation, First Solar Holdings, Inc.
